Stoller Vineyards Dundee Hills Pinot Noir, 2015


Just a slight difference in alcohol content, compared to the Calstar Cellars Pinot that preceded it at the table, made a big difference. While both wines were very good, most at the table agreed that this Willamette Valley wine had better balance and more interesting flavors.

Medium deep but a bit lighter than the Calstar Cellars. Cherries, anise seed, black pepper and orange zest. The zesty, peppery quality was immediately recognized by those at the table. The light, silky texture, though, was what set the wine apart for me. Flavors that open up and get more complex as the meal progresses. An excellent wine..
